As predicted in Sowetan on Tuesday, star defender Lucas Thwala won major awards at the glittering Orlando Pirates end-of- season function in Benoni, Ekurhuleni, last night.

Thwala, who is also in the Bafana Bafana squad for the Confederations Cup, pocketed a cool R170000 for scooping three major awards.

He deservedly grabbed the player of the season (R90000), players' player of the season (R40000) and Golden Boot awards (R40000).

Also known as "Look Around" to close associates, Thwala rattled the net nine times in the Absa Premiership to win the Golden Boot.

Thwala is one of the most successful players to come through the development ranks of Pirates, who finished second on the Absa Premiership log this past season, in the process qualifying for the 2010 African Champions League.

"It's a great honour and I want to thank everybody who contributed to the success of the club this season, we were just unlucky not to win the league," said Thwala.

"But I must say congratulations to SuperSport United for defending their league title, but we have laid a solid foundation for next season."

Back to the awards, Teko "General Rau Rau" Modise was presented with R30000 for winning the club's online player of the season award.

"We have over 15000 people visiting our website daily, which is incredible and we thank them for their continued support," said Irvin Khoza, Bucs chairman.

Dikgang "Terminator" Mabalane was rewarded with R20000 for winning the goal of the season for the awesome goal in their 1-all draw against Free State Stars.

Siphelele Mthembu left with the most improved player of the season award after impressing on his debut season in the professional ranks.

Mthembu received R30000, while Rooi Mahamutsa got the same amount for winning the prospect of the season award.

For the Chairman's Award, Benson Mhlongo got R40000, while Musa Sokhulu was given R20000 for winning the supporters award.

"Musa is from Durban but he has been to all the games we played throughout the season," explained Khoza afterwards.

Khoza also presented the club's kit department with a special recognition award, which goes with a R20000 cash prize.

"The kit department were simply the best, Orlando Pirates were smartly dressed this season and we appreciate it as management," he said.
